The role of six biomarkers in diagnosis of hemophilic arthropathy: review of the literature
The aim of our narrative review of the literature is to identify the role of six important biomarkers: synovial fluid thrombomodulin, fibroblast-like synoviocytes, synovial tissue growth factor , vascular endothelial growth factor in synovium and peripheral blood, urinary C-terminal telopeptide of type II collagen, and synovial fluid tumor necrosis factor alpha. These urinary, serum and synovial biomarkers illustrated should be evaluated in patients with hemophilic arthropathy for early diagnosis of hemophilic arthropathy, because they have important implications in the development of arthrofibrosis, altered inflammatory response and bleeding. Moreover, better knowledge of their biological activity is important to identify possible new biological treatment options
Consensus recommendations for the use of FEIBA<sup>®</sup> in haemophilia A patients with inhibitors undergoing elective orthopaedic and non-orthopaedic surgery
Summary: A growing number of publications have described the efficacy and safety of FEIBA as a first-line haemostatic agent for surgical procedures in haemophilia A patients with high-responding FVIII inhibitors. The aim of this study was to provide practical guidance on patient management and selection and also to communicate a standardized approach to the dosing and monitoring of FEIBA during and after surgery. A consensus group was convened with the aims of (i) providing an overview of the efficacy and safety of FEIBA in surgery; (ii) sharing best practice; (iii) developing recommendations based on the outcome of (i) and (ii). To date there have been 17 publications reporting on the use of FEIBA in over 210 major and minor orthopaedic and non-orthopaedic surgical procedures. Haemostatic outcome was rated as 'excellent' or 'good' in 78-100% of major cases. The reporting of thromboembolic complications or anamnestic response to FEIBA was very rare. Key to the success of FEIBA as haemostatic cover in surgery is to utilize the preplanning phase to prepare the patient both for surgery and also for rehabilitation. Haemostatic control with FEIBA should be continued for an adequate period postoperatively to support wound healing and to cover what can in some patients be an extended period of physiotherapy. Published data have demonstrated that FEIBA can provide adequate, well tolerated, peri and postoperative haemostatic cover for a variety of major and minor surgical procedures in patients with haemophilia A. The consensus recommendations provide a standardized approach to the dosing and monitoring of FEIBA.</p

DSC evaluation of thermoxidative decomposition of extra virgin olive oil: effect of microwave and conventional heating
The aim of this work was to evaluate DSC thermal properties of extra virgin olive oil subjected to microwave and thermal heating. Fresh extra virgin olive oil was stored in dark bottles under nitrogen at room temperature before analysis. Sample were placed in a 250 ml open flask and either heated in an electric oven (with air convection) at 180°C for 30, 90, 120, 180, 360, 900 and 1440 min, or microwaved (at 2450 MHz, 0.72 kW) for 3, 6, 9, 12, 15 and 20 min. All samples were cooled at room temperature in the dark to 30°C and then analyzed. Thermograms were obtained by means of DSC, by cooling from 30 to -80°C at 2°C/min, holding 3 min at -80°C and heating from -80 to 30°C at 2°C/min. Enthalpy (H, J/g), onset (Ton), and offset (Toff) temperatures of the transitions were obtained.
Lipid crystallization Ton of fresh extra virgin olive oil was at -11°C and developed over a 35–40 degrees range. Two well defined events (minor, peaking at -16 and major peaking at -40°C) were distinguishable. Heating thermograms of fresh sample showed a minor exothermic peak and successively a major endothermic event occurring over the -18°C/12°C temperature range, with the presence of a major endothermic peak (-5°C) and a small shoulder at 8°C.
Enthalpy of both crystallization and melting transition significantly decreased in all samples with increasing length of heating treatment; this effect was more pronounced for the microwaved sample. Crystallization peak line-shape dramatically changed with increasing heating time. The major crystallization peak decreased in height, and the transition spanned over a larger temperature range, because of a significant shift of Toff towards lower temperatures. Crystallization Ton remain constant in conventionally heated samples, whereas it significantly shifted towards higher temperature in samples microwaved for at least 12 min. Melting line-shapes also dramatically changed; in fact, the major endothermic peak flattened, decreased in height, and spanned over a larger temperature range, while the minor endothermic peak disappeared in the longest treated samples. An additional endothermic peak also appeared at lower temperature after 20 and 900 min of microwave and conventional treatment, respectively. Ton of the heating transition significantly shifted towards lower temperatures at increasing treatment time.
In conclusion, changes in all thermal properties were already evident in microwaved samples after 9 minutes of treatment, whereas similar values were reached after 360 min of air convection heating
HJHS 2.1 and HEAD-US assessment in the hemophilic joints: How do their findings compare?
: In hemophilic patients methods are needed to better diagnose joint damage early, so that treatments can be adjusted to slow the progression of hemophilic arthropathy. The aim of this study is to investigate the relationship between the Hemophilia Joint Health Score version 2.1 (HJHS 2.1) and hemophilia early arthropathy detection with ultrasound (HEAD-US) scales, as well as each of their individual items, to better understand the value each provides on the joint condition of patients with hemophilia. The study included data from patients with hemophilia older than 16 years of age, who attended a routine check-up. HJHS 2.1 and HEAD-US assessments were performed on the elbows, knees and ankles. We studied the correlations and agreements between the two scales and analyzed the relationship between the various items of the HJHS 2.1 (inflammation, duration, atrophy, crepitation, flexion deficit, extension deficit, pain, strength, gait) and HEAD-US (synovitis, cartilage and bone). The study included 203 joints from 66 patients with hemophilia (mean age, 34 years). We found a good correlation between the two scales (r = 0.717). However, HJHS 2.1 revealed only 54% of the cases with synovitis and 75% of the cases with osteochondral damage. HEAD-US detected several relevant physical and functional aspects in less than 53% of the cases. HJHS 2.1 and HEAD-US provide complementary data on joint disease in adults with hemophilia; both assessments should therefore, be made available. HEAD-US presented the added value of detecting early joint changes (synovitis and osteochondral damage), while HJHS 2.1 showed the added value of detecting relevant physical and functional changes
